I’m sorry to hear that you’re facing an issue with the internal linking column not showing up after marking your posts as pillar content.
Based on the information provided in our knowledge base, the internal link suggestions feature in Rank Math is limited to posts in the same category. If your posts are marked as pillar content but are in different categories, you may not see the internal linking column.
To resolve this issue, please ensure that the posts you want to link internally are in the same category. This should enable the internal linking suggestions to appear for your pillar content.
